Mumbai: Man held for hoax call about 'terror attack' at Hotel Taj

The Mumbai crime branch's unit 9 traced the caller to Santacruz in Mumbai and arrested him for making a hoax call, an official said

Mumbai Police have arrested a 36-year-old man for allegedly making a hoax call about a 'terror attack' at the iconic Hotel Taj in south Mumbai, an official said on Friday, according to the PTI.

The crime branch began an investigation after the city police's main control room on Thursday received a call about the 'terror attack', the official said.
